전람회
Korean
    
    Etymology
    
Sino-Korean word from 展覽會 (“exhibition”).
Pronunciation
    
- (SK Standard/Seoul) IPA(key): [ˈt͡ɕɘ(ː)ɭɭa̠mβwe̞] ~ [ˈt͡ɕɘ(ː)ɭɭa̠mɦø̞]
- Phonetic hangul: [절(ː)람훼/절(ː)람회]- Though still prescribed in Standard Korean, most speakers in both Koreas no longer distinguish vowel length.
 
| Romanizations | |
|---|---|
| Revised Romanization? | jeollamhoe | 
| Revised Romanization (translit.)? | jeonlamhoe | 
| McCune–Reischauer? | chŏllamhoe | 
| Yale Romanization? | cēnlamhoy |
